Prepare for Your Adventure: Budget Travel Tips
Are you eager to embark on an exciting adventure but concerned about your budget? Fret not! With careful planning and smart choices, you can make your travel dreams a reality without breaking the bank. Here are some handy budget travel tips to help you along the way.
1. Research and Plan Ahead
Start by researching your destination thoroughly. Look for off-peak seasons, budget accommodations, and cost-effective transportation options. Planning ahead allows you to take advantage of early booking discounts and special deals.
2. Pack Light and Smart
Traveling light not only saves you money on baggage fees but also makes moving around easier. Pack versatile clothing items that can be mixed and matched, and don't forget essentials like a reusable water bottle and a travel-sized first aid kit.
3. Eat like a Local
One of the best ways to experience a new culture is through its food. Skip the touristy restaurants and opt for local eateries or street vendors. Not only will you get a taste of authentic cuisine, but you'll also save money in the process.
4. Use Public Transportation
Public transportation is not only budget-friendly but also a great way to explore a destination like a local. Research bus and subway routes in advance, or consider renting a bike for a more eco-friendly and affordable option.
5. Embrace Free Activities
Many cities offer free walking tours, museum days, or outdoor activities. Take advantage of these opportunities to explore your destination without spending a dime. Check local event listings or ask for recommendations from hostel staff or locals.
6. Stay in Hostels or Budget Accommodations
Hostels are a fantastic option for budget travelers, offering affordable dormitory or private room options. Additionally, consider alternative accommodations like guesthouses, homestays, or budget hotels for a more authentic experience at a lower cost.
7. Be Flexible with Your Plans
Flexibility is key when traveling on a budget. Stay open to last-minute deals, changes in itinerary, or alternative transportation options. Being flexible allows you to adapt to unexpected situations and make the most of your travel budget.
